Colour
Consistency for tanning ostrich leather.
One
of the important critical points of leather tanning is controlling
colour consistency. The shoe, clothing and fashion industry is dependent
on receiving consistent coloured leather to manufacture items through
out the season.
The tanning of the leather is as much as a skill as it is an art.
The influence of the epidermis, corium and adipose tissue can have
influence on dying. Especially in the case of ostrich leather, the
quill needs to be considered. It is essential that the tanner understands
the dynamics of each hide in order to keep the consistency between
dying batches.
